## Break-Glass: Cronwrangle Migration

Quick note for the weekly sync: we're moving the last legacy cron jobs into Flowperch this sprint. If the scheduler wedges mid-migration, break-glass access to the Cronwrangle admin shell is still live. Don't improvise — use the documented path. To unlock the emergency console, enter the recovery passphrase below.

vault phrase of bagaf-kajeg = jorath-feniel-briir-siliel-ralix

ALERT: PointsPath ledger drift. Triggers when the Emberline loyalty-points ledger's running balance diverges from the event-sourced total by more than 50 points across any account. Reviewer: this usually traces to a merge that reorders award/redeem events or skips the idempotency check in the ledger writer. Inspect the offending commit's changes to apply_event before approving hotfixes. Replays are safe; manual balance edits are not. If drift persists after replay, report it to the ledger owners.

escalation mailbox, bafog-fafog: ulador@paliqlabs.internal

## Local Setup — FeedCheck

FeedCheck validates podcast RSS feeds before publish. Requirements: Python 3.12, Redis running locally.

1. Clone the repo, run `make deps`.
2. Copy `settings.example.toml` to `settings.toml`.
3. Run `make seed` to load sample feeds.
4. Start with `make run`; validator listens on port 8085.

On-call note: if validation jobs stall, check the jobs table directly. Point your client at the following:

replica DSN, kajep-yahag: mssql://praok_svc:iF@db-8d68.plorvaio.local:5432/eliion

### Scanner Thresholds

The Hollowcrate registry runs every new package name through the typo-squat scanner before publish. Plugin authors extending the matcher should know that detection combines edit distance against popular package names, keyboard-adjacency weighting, and publisher age. Packages exceeding the composite score are quarantined pending review. These thresholds are exposed read-only to plugins via the scanner context object. The defaults are given below.

tuning constants:
QUOTAS = {
    "druwyn": 5,
    "holix": 5,
    "zorath": 5,
    "holwyn": 10,
}